Nineteen-year-old South African cricket sensation Dewald Brevis has the world at his feet.
Considered a once-in-generation talent like his mentor and Proteas legend, AB de Villiers, he announced himself to a worldwide audience at this year’s International Cricket Council (ICC) Under-19 Men’s World Cup by breaking the longstanding record for most runs scored at a single tournament.
Those 506 runs in just six innings were ample reason for the Mumbai Indians to purchase him for R6 million at the player auction for this year’s edition of the lucrative Indian Premier League T20 tournament.
